Since Caliper events were introduced, some Caliper events have been mistakenly classified as events triggered by an application (where an agent is a software application), instead of end-user trigged events (where the agent is a person).
The Caliper event transformation logic has been updated to classify events as a person-triggered event if an event not only has user data but also request data. As a result of the change, you might see an influx in person-generated messages in Caliper format.
The change will be effective as of Monday, 12 October 2020.
